Abstract: A mesh network includes an array of stationary sensing devices. Each of the devices is controlled by a microprocessor control unit and has a sensor capable of detecting a non-stationary object that enters a detection range of the sensor. A wireless communication component allows the sensing devices to wirelessly communicate with any other sensing devices or mobile phones within communication range. The devices include a power harvesting component that collects energy from the environment and a power capacitor that stores the collected energy. The devices automatically communicate data concerning any detected non-stationary objects to a central server.

Abstract: A protective case for a portable electronic device includes a rigid plastic frame bonded to a stretchable rubber cover and a back panel insert that can be removably inserted into a pocket in the rear of the stretchable rubber cover and plastic frame. To position a device in the case, the device is simply inserted into the front opening of the rigid plastic frame and stretchable rubber cover such that the edges of the stretchable cover stretch over the device and secure the device in the case. A variety of different removable back panels allow the stand to be easily reconfigured to include a stand for the device case, a pocket adapted to hold payment cards, a folding style wallet, a mirror or a fabric covering.
Abstract: A water resistant device case includes a front and back assembly that mate to enclose an electronic device. The front assembly includes a rigid front frame, a touch screen cover bonded to the front frame, an inner bumper attached to the rigid front frame and an elastomeric main seal attached around a periphery of the rigid front frame. The back assembly includes a rigid back frame, an elastomeric over mold formed on an exterior of the black frame and an inner bumper attached to the rigid back frame. A snap tab attached to the rigid back frame mates with a snap hook on the front assembly to hold the front and back assemblies together when the device is enclosed within the case. A main water resistant seal is formed around a perimeter of the front and back assemblies by the elastomeric main seal on the front assembly being held against an inner surface of the rigid back frame.
